Country star Lauren Alaina shares how Miranda Lambert gave her a reality check about the music industry during an impromptu first meeting.

Alaina, 31, recently recalled a time when she appeared on “Taste of Country Nights.” He was asked who had given him the best advice in his career and in his personal life, and he said Lambert was responsible for giving him some solid advice.

“Miranda Lambert – I ran into the BMI Awards, in the bathroom. It was my first time meeting her, and she was like, ‘Don’t let this town or anybody change who you are. You’re a sweet Southern girl, and always will be,'” the “Road Less Traveled” singer shared.

“I didn’t even know he knew who I was. It was the best time ever,” he added.

Alaina first appeared in the music industry at the age of 15 on the stage of “American Idol.” He was successful in the singing show and reached the final in 2011. He finished second as Scotty McCreery took first.
